The farmers' organization Kisan Janata, affiliated with the Rashtriya Janata Dal, has criticized the state government's plan to stop using service cooperative banks for distributing social welfare pensions. They argue this change, which would transfer payments directly to Aadhaar-linked commercial bank accounts, will negatively impact elderly and economically disadvantaged individuals by forcing them to queue at banks or ATMs. The group claims the current system via cooperative banks provides a more convenient and accessible method of delivering pensions, especially for older people who face difficulties accessing banking services.
